When Is the Best Time to Prune Pine Trees?
Determining the optimal time for tree pruning in Falls Church, VA, depends on several factors. The primary consideration revolves around the growth cycle of pine trees and when they are most receptive to pruning. Here’s a breakdown:
1. Seasonal Considerations: Spring vs. Fall
Pine trees, like many conifers, experience distinct growth phases throughout the year. When to prune trees in Virginia is best addressed by understanding these cycles. Generally, pine trees are dormant during the colder months, making late winter or early spring the ideal time for pruning. This period allows trees to redirect their energy towards new growth and healing.

2. Growth Stages and Healing Time
Pine trees go through several growth stages, each with its own pruning considerations:
- Early Spring: This is typically the prime time for severe restructuring cuts to promote new growth. It’s best left to professionals who understand pine tree anatomy to avoid damaging the tree.
- Summer: Pine trees are actively growing during this season, making it less ideal for extensive pruning. Light trimming and dead branch removal are recommended during summer to prevent stress on the tree.
- Fall: As mentioned, fall offers a period of reduced activity in pine trees, allowing for more significant pruning while minimizing damage and providing time for healing.
3. Weather Conditions: A Factor in Pruning Timing
Local weather patterns play a crucial role in determining when to prune. In Falls Church, VA, mild winters and hot summers influence the tree’s growth cycle. Here are some key considerations:
- Avoid Pruning During Extreme Weather: Harsh cold or prolonged drought conditions can stress pine trees, making pruning during these times risky. Aim for periods of moderate temperatures and adequate moisture.
- Post-Storm Care: After severe storms or high winds, inspect your pines for damaged branches. Prompt removal of these branches is essential to prevent decay and insect infestations.

Types of Pine Tree Pruning Services in Falls Church VA
Tree pruning services falls church va encompass a range of techniques tailored to different pine species and specific needs:
1. Crown Reduction and Thinning
This involves selectively removing branches to reduce the overall size of the tree while maintaining its natural shape. It’s ideal for properties with power lines or other structures where overhead clearance is necessary. Local experts use specialized tools to ensure clean cuts and minimize damage.
2. Deadwooding and Cleaning
Removing dead, diseased, or damaged branches (deadwood) is crucial for pine tree health. Fall church tree removal experts employ careful techniques to eliminate these branches without causing further harm to the tree. Proper cleaning promotes new growth and prevents pest attraction.
3. Structural Pruning
For young pines or trees with abnormal growth patterns, structural pruning helps shape the tree and encourage desirable branch development. This technique promotes long-term health and stability.
